查看: 308|回复: 2
打印 上一主题 下一主题

【Seeed开发板试用体验】技巧篇(4)BBG使用SD卡自启动

[复制链接] qrcode

25

主题

26

帖子

80

积分

注册会员

Rank: 2

积分
80
楼主
跳转到指定楼层
发表于 2015-12-5 09:47 PM |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

    不管是Beaglebone Green,还是Beaglebone Black,抑或Beaglebone White,都支持4种启动方法,具体可查看BBB手册的35页,其中有下面一段话:

    也就是说,它们支持4种启动模式,分别为eMMC启动,SD卡启动,串口(Serial)启动和USB启动。但常用的是前两种,系统默认以eMMC方式启动。但在开发过程中,以SD卡启动的方式居多,而要想使Beaglebone Green以SD卡启动,需要按下板上的boot键,这样在开发过程中,就无意中增加了“手续”,如果可以设置其默认以SD卡启动,岂不更好!

    具体设置Bealgebone Green,默认以SD卡启动的方法(不需要按下boot键):

1 将BBB flash(emmc)上的bootloader(MLO文件)更名

#mount /dev/mmcblk1p1 /mnt
#cd /mnt
#mv MLO MLO.bk
#umount /mnt/

2 在macro SD卡上安装新的系统,使用SD启动新系统(由于BBB eMMC已经没有bootloader文件,BBB就直接从SD卡启动)

3.修复emmc上的MLO,以便能够恢复从BBB flash中启动
#mount /dev/mmcblk1p1 /mnt
#cd /mnt
#mv MLO.bk MLO


ps:

fdisk -l查看分区信息






本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

0

主题

97

帖子

30

积分

新手上路

Rank: 1

积分
30
沙发
发表于 2015-12-5 10:07 PM | 只看该作者
兄弟,我已经关注你很久了
回复 支持 反对

使用道具 举报

0

主题

73

帖子

26

积分

新手上路

Rank: 1

积分
26
板凳
发表于 2015-12-5 10:26 PM | 只看该作者
呵呵,谢谢支持,一起学习!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

快速回复 返回顶部 返回列表